While having THREE 1st Round picks is fantastic, with the way this draft is the real value is having extra 2nd and 3rd Round picks.  I know loads of posters here would love to trade back one of our 1sts and pickup another 2023 1st to have extra ammo to get a QB should we not be able to do anything about that this off-season, but I'd be fine with adding extra 2nd/3rd Rounders this draft and with 3 picks in the 5th we have some ammo to trade up (a few to a handful of picks) to make sure we get our guy.

I am looking over who has extra picks and would want a trade up, especially for a QB, and what the potential (ballpark) trade would be and these are some possible players:

Denver.  Maybe they don't go QB with #9 and simply go BPA, but then look to trade back into the 1st Round (at our #19 just ahead of PGH at #20) to get the QB they want.  They have the Rams 2nd and 3rd Round picks along with their own in those rounds so a potential trade could be we give them #19 and they give us #s 40, 64, and 96.

Detroit.  They have the Rams 1st Round pick for both 2022 and 2023.  Perhaps they take Hutch at #2 and then want to trade up from 32 to 19 to get a QB?  In that scenario they could either swap up 19 for 32 and give us the Rams 2023 1st or if they preferred to keep two 2023 1sts then they could swap up 19 for 32 while also giving us 66, 177, and 180. 

Dark horse:  NYJ.  They have 2 picks in each of rounds 1, 2, 4, and 5.  They aren't trading up for a QB, but if there's a DL/OL player they really covet then they have the ammo to do it.  A trade could look like we give them 19 and 204 and they give us 35, 69, 110, and 163.

Those are teams with extra picks and/or the need for a QB.  Of course, any other team could want to jump up for any specific player they really want.  Hell, if either of Gardner or (pipe dream) Hamilton falls to the NYJ at 10 or MIN at 12 I could see Howie making a little trade up in those scenarios so you never know.  Howie does like to move around the board.
